Kwalee is one of the world’s leading multiplatform game publishers and developers, with well over 750 million downloads worldwide for mobile hits such as Draw It, Teacher Simulator, Let’s Be Cops 3D, Airport Security and Makeover Studio 3D. Alongside this, we also have a growing PC and Console team of incredible pedigree that is on the hunt for great new titles to join TENS!, Eternal Hope, Die by the Blade and Scathe.
We have a team of talented people collaborating daily between our studios in Leamington Spa, Bangalore and Beijing, or on a remote basis from Turkey, Brazil, the Philippines and many more places, and we’ve recently acquired our first external studio, TicTales which is based in France. We have a truly global team making games for a global audience. And it’s paying off: Kwalee has been recognised with the Best Large Studio and Best Leadership awards from TIGA (The Independent Game Developers’ Association) and our games have been downloaded in every country on earth!
Founded in 2011 by David Darling CBE, a key architect of the UK games industry who previously co-founded and led Codemasters for many years, our team also includes legends such as Andrew Graham (creator of Micro Machines series) and Jason Falcus (programmer of classics including NBA Jam) alongside a growing and diverse team of global gaming experts. As an IT Support Technician you will make sure the office computers and network are running smoothly, you'll adapt to changing technology and support a fast growing company.
What you tell your friends you do
I manage a very complicated network and maintain top of the line computers so that we can make tons of games each year.
What you will really be doing
Install and configure computer hardware, operating systems and software applications
Monitor and maintain computer systems and networks
Troubleshoot system and network problems, diagnosing and solving hardware or software faults
Create clear and concise procedural documentation and reports
Support the roll-out of new applications
Set up new users' accounts and profiles
Test and evaluate new technology
